
Rain barrels collect and store rain water for outdoor water use, allowing homeowners to save on water bills, and provide a water source during summer watering restrictions. In New England, rain barrels can save as much as 1,700 gallons of water during the extended summer months. Rain barrels are low cost and easy to install.
The rain barrel is repurposed from a 60 gallon shipping drum. A drum is 39" tall by 24" wide, 20 lbs. empty. The shipping drum is made from 3/16" polyethylene which is UV protected and BPA free. The barrel comes complete with overflow fittings, drain plug, screw on cover, and a threaded spigot with a choice of two ports to use with either a watering can or a garden hose. The rain barrel arrives with simple instructions for fast and easy installation.
